HRW1002A S
Silicon Schottky Barrier Diode
for Rectifying
Rev. 1
Aug. 1994
Features
Pin Arrangement
• Low forward voltage drop and suitable for high
effifiency rectifying.
• Same power as TO-220AB.
• Small outline compared with TO-220AB.
• LDPAK S package is suitable for high density
surface mounting.
